Recently bought this 89 70hp Yamaha motor. The previous owner said the water pump needed to be replaced. The engine started right up and sounded good. Only ran it for about 30 seconds. Prior to starting I did a compression check which was good the plugs were clean and there was no discoloration or signs of being over heated. After bringing the motor home I pulled the lower unit to do the impeller replacement and found the impeller in pieces. See photo. My question now is, is there a way to flush the cooling passages on that motor? I removed the pick-up screens and blew down from the water pump and blew out quite a few pieces of the impeller from there. I just don't know what may have gotten up into the motor.
